For the 2026 European Heritage Days, come and discover the’Notre-Dame-Saint-Vincent church, a magnificent neoclassical inspired building ideally located on the banks of the Saône at the bottom of the slopes of Croix-Rousse.
Built in the mid-19th century on the site of a former Augustinian convent, this church houses remarkable murals, an impressive high altar, and a collection of exquisitely crafted sculptures. This guided tour will reveal the little-known history of this building and its surrounding neighborhood.
